Cypress family gets to final World Cup match in Houston after StubHub fiasco saw tickets canceled to earlier match
By Mario Díaz, Austin McAfee at KPRC 2 Houston (NBC / Click2Houston)
· July 6, 2026
· 4 min read
Over the past 10 days, three separate families who experienced canceled StubHub orders ultimately received tickets after seeking assistance from 2 Helps You. In each case, family members were provided tickets to eventually attend a match, but not all received tickets for the games they originally...
